I love that this place has been ranked as one of the top 10 boardwalks in the country by Food & Wine magazine. We are just leaving after another fun family getaway. Our children loved the fair and rides when they were young and of course the beach is still a favorite. The boardwalk makes for a great walk along the beach if you don’t want to get your toes sandy. Would be great if it could be extended. Love the commemorative fish and the swing chairs the overlook the ocean. There are plenty of good options for casual beachfront dining and satisfying any sweet cravings.
-
Interesting fact: the Carolina beach boardwalk was originally built in 1887 but the latest improvements/additions were finished in the early 2000's which brought it up to its current 1/4 mile length. My visit was on hot and lazy mid-July day. I traveled here on a Wednesday to avoid the weekend crowds but there were still a decent about of beach goers stretched out along the sands. As a California transplant, I'm quite taken by North Carolina beaches. For one, the coastline is not nearly as developed as Southern California with stifling traffic and miles of concrete. The eastern NC coastline is, by contrast, sparsely populated (Wilmington is the only "large" city) and is dotted with quaint, cozy little villages. Many, from my view, give almost a Caribbean vibe and feel, if that makes any sense. Then there are the unique physical features such as the sand dunes and wide variety of marsh vegetation. And of course, the warm water! It was 81º in water here today compared to a chilly 65 in Santa Monica beach. On the boardwalk, I particularly loved the shaded overlook that offered expansive views of the beach in all directions. Also impressive was how clean the are is maintained, I didn't see any litter along the path. The only slight disappointment was that many of the cafes and eateries close after lunch and don't reopen till around 4 of 5 pm for dinner. In all, a great place to bring the family and spend a the day...
